PRU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

733 of the 3,447 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Prudential Financial (PRU)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$26.1B — down 7.4% from $28.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 65 funds opened new PRU positions and 33 closed out — a net gain of 32 holders — while 287 added to existing stakes and 252 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$118M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, cutting an estimated $1.21B.
